In Which Scenarios Are Speakers with Such Plastic Glossy Convex Caps Widely Used?
Speakers with plastic glossy convex caps are widely used in scenarios that prioritize cost-effectiveness, flexible installation space requirements, and do not demand extreme sound quality, thanks to their advantages of economic cost, basic protection, and strong adaptability, as well as stable full-frequency/mid-to-high frequency sound performance. They can be specifically categorized into the following types:

1. Consumer-Grade Small Electronic Devices
These devices have high requirements for the "cost-performance ratio" and "space compatibility" of speakers, and the lightweight and easy-to-process characteristics of plastic glossy convex caps fit well:
Portable audio devices: Such as mini Bluetooth speakers, card-inserted small speakers, and children's storytellers. The convex cap design does not occupy excessive internal space, and the glossy appearance can also match the simple texture of the devices.
Personal digital products: Such as entry-level tablets, small voice recorders, and portable translators. They are mainly used for voice playback and prompt sound output. The basic dustproof effect of the plastic cap can protect the speaker unit while controlling the overall cost of the device.
2. Smart Home and Security Devices
These scenarios require speakers to operate stably for a long time and are mostly installed in a hidden way, so the durability and adaptability of plastic glossy caps are particularly prominent:
Smart home terminals: Such as entry-level smart speakers, smart doorbells (non-high-definition sound quality models), and smart switch panels (with voice prompt functions). The convex cap structure is easy to embed into the device shell, and the plastic material is resistant to temperature and moisture, adapting to the daily home environment.
Security and early warning devices: Such as simple smoke alarms, door and window sensors (with sound and light prompts), and household gas leakage alarms. They are mainly used to emit high-frequency warning sounds. The plastic glossy cap does not affect sound penetration, and its low cost is suitable for large-scale deployment.
3. Small Home Appliances and Daily Electrical Appliances
In home appliance scenarios, speakers mostly play the role of "function prompts" or "basic audio output", and plastic glossy convex caps can balance cost and practicality:
Kitchen/bathroom small home appliances: Such as mini electric cookers (with operation prompt sounds), bathroom radios, and small humidifiers (with working status prompts). The water resistance of plastic is better than that of paper caps, and the convex cap design can reduce direct contact between water vapor and the unit.
Daily auxiliary appliances: Such as electronic scales (with voice broadcast), electric toothbrushes (with mode prompts), and small fans (with gear prompts). The small-sized convex cap can be easily integrated into the compact shell of electrical appliances, and the cost is controllable.

4. Outdoor and Portable Tool Devices
Outdoor scenarios have certain requirements for the "weather resistance" and "cost-performance ratio" of speakers, and the protection and economy of plastic glossy convex caps are suitable for such needs:
Outdoor portable devices: Such as low-cost outdoor Bluetooth speakers (non-professional waterproof models), camping night lights (with sound effect functions), and handheld walkie-talkies (entry-level models). The plastic cap can resist slight dust and rain splashes, and the convex cap structure is not easy to accumulate dust.
Small tools and equipment: Such as electric screwdrivers (with power prompt sounds), portable land area measuring instruments, and small projectors (entry-level audio output). They are mainly used for function prompts. The stability and low maintenance cost of plastic glossy cap speakers meet the positioning of tool products.
5. Children's and Educational Products
These products need to balance "safety", "cost" and "durability", making speakers with plastic glossy convex caps a preferred choice:
Children's toys: Such as electric toy cars, plastic early education machines, and sound-producing dolls. The plastic cap has no sharp edges, is not easy to break, and the convex cap design can withstand slight collisions. Its low cost is suitable for mass production of toys.
Educational equipment: Such as entry-level point-reading pens (non-high-definition sound quality models), small teaching amplifiers (entry-level models), and children's electronic drawing boards (with sound effects). They are mainly used for voice explanation or simple sound effects, and the stability of plastic glossy cap speakers meets the needs of long-term use.
